theory StarForth_Transition
imports StarForth_Mutex
begin
(* =========================================================================
StarForth_Transition — Labeled Transition System
SPECIFICATION ROLE: ground truth for how ExecThread and HeartbeatThread
interact. C code must be written so that every execution of vm_tick()
satisfies heartbeat_exec_neutral and every word satisfies
word_physics_transparent.
EXPLICIT AXIOM INVENTORY (this theory) — 2 axioms total:
A1 ×1 heartbeat_exec_neutral (C audit: src/vm_time.c)
A4'×1 word_physics_transparent (definition audit: Level 1 word theories)
The former 8 field axioms are now PROVED from A1 via exec_equiv. The
physics substate (rolling_window, heartbeat rate, decay_slope_q48, …) is
intentionally unconstrained — the heartbeat is designed to evolve it
non-monotonically. exec_equiv makes that silence explicit and structural.
======================================================================== *)
(* =========================================================================
Section 1: Thread and action datatypes
======================================================================== *)
datatype thread = ExecThread | HeartbeatThread
datatype action =
ExecWord nat
| HeartTick
| AcquireTuning nat
| ReleaseTuning nat
| AcquireDict nat
| ReleaseDict nat
type_synonym event = "thread \<times> action"
(* =========================================================================
Section 2: Exec-equivalence — the quotient that separates exec from physics
Two vm_states are exec-equivalent when they agree on every field that word
execution depends on. Physics fields are ABSENT by design: the heartbeat
is an adaptive non-monotone controller of those fields, and no ordering or
preservation claim is made about them here.
exec_equiv is the congruence that collapses heartbeat_step to the identity
in the exec quotient vm_state/≃, and under which word execution is a
well-defined endomorphism.
======================================================================== *)
definition exec_equiv :: "vm_state \<Rightarrow> vm_state \<Rightarrow> bool" (infix "\<simeq>" 50) where
"s1 \<simeq> s2 \<longleftrightarrow>
data_stack s1 = data_stack s2 \<and>
return_stack s1 = return_stack s2 \<and>
memory s1 = memory s2 \<and>
word_table s1 = word_table s2"
lemma exec_equiv_refl [simp, intro]: "vm \<simeq> vm"
by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
lemma exec_equiv_sym: "s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> s2 \<simeq> s1"
by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
lemma exec_equiv_trans: "s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> s2 \<simeq> s3 \<Longrightarrow> s1 \<simeq> s3"
by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
lemma exec_equiv_ds: "s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> data_stack s1 = data_stack s2" by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
lemma exec_equiv_rs: "s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> return_stack s1 = return_stack s2" by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
lemma exec_equiv_mem:"s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> memory s1 = memory s2" by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
lemma exec_equiv_wt: "s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> word_table s1 = word_table s2" by (simp add: exec_equiv_def)
(* =========================================================================
Section 3: Heartbeat axiom — A1 ×1 (collapsed from ×8)
The heartbeat step is the IDENTITY in the exec quotient: heartbeat_step vm
and vm are exec-equivalent. This is the only claim the proof framework
makes about heartbeat_step relative to exec-visible state.
The physics substate (rolling_window, heartbeat rate, decay_slope_q48,
pipeline_metrics, last_inference, ssm_l8, tuning_lock, dict_lock, heat
thresholds, dictionary, vm_error, vm_halted, vm_mode) is not mentioned —
the heartbeat may evolve it freely, non-monotonically, as the adaptive
feedback loops require. That freedom is the design intent.
⚠ AUDIT OBLIGATION (src/vm_time.c):
Read every code path reachable from vm_tick() — including
vm_tick_window_tuner, vm_tick_slope_validator, and all
inference_engine.c callees — and verify that NONE of those paths write
to the following four fields:
data_stack (vm->data_stack / vm->ds_top)
return_stack (vm->return_stack / vm->rs_top)
memory (vm->memory[])
word_table (vm->word_table)
Those four fields are exactly exec_equiv. Everything else is free.
○ CODE-MUST-MATCH: if a future refactor moves any of those four fields into
the heartbeat's write set, exec_equiv must be updated and a new audit
performed before the axiom can be accepted.
======================================================================== *)
axiomatization heartbeat_step :: "vm_state \<Rightarrow> vm_state"
where
heartbeat_exec_neutral: "heartbeat_step vm \<simeq> vm"

(* =========================================================================
Section 6: Word physics transparency — A4' ×1 (congruence form)
Word execution is a well-defined endomorphism on the exec quotient: if two
states are exec-equivalent, executing any word on each produces identical
results. This is the congruence law that makes word sequences independent
of interleaved heartbeat ticks.
⚠ AUDIT PROTOCOL: for each word registered in word_table, verify its body
only reads data_stack, return_stack, memory, word_table — the four fields
of exec_equiv. These are exactly the fields a FORTH word may observe.
○ CODE-MUST-MATCH: no word in src/word_source/ may read rolling_window,
heartbeat, decay_slope_q48, pipeline_metrics, last_inference, ssm_l8,
tuning_lock, dict_lock, heat thresholds, or any other physics field.
======================================================================== *)
axiomatization where
word_physics_transparent:
"\<And> (s1 :: vm_state) (s2 :: vm_state) n.
s1 \<simeq> s2 \<Longrightarrow> word_table s1 n s1 = word_table s2 n s2"
